191 191  == Re-Patching Fixtures ==
192 192  
193 -Since ShowRunner™ uses fixture groups to send commands to DMX fixtures on the Pharos LPC, the specific fixture addresses do not matter as long as they are addressed according to the Pharos project. This means that if fixtures are re-patched to different addresses in the Pharos project but kept in the same fixture groups, then no changes to the ShowRunner™ configuration are necessary.
193 +Since ShowRunner™ uses fixture groups to send commands to DMX fixtures on the Pharos LPC, the specific fixture universe and address does not matter as long as fixtures have been addressed according to the Pharos project. This means that if fixtures were installed and connected to a different universe than originally anticipated, it is relatively straightforward to re-patch fixtureto different addresses on different universes while maintaining their groups in the Pharos project without requiring changes to the ShowRunner™ configuration.

225 225  1. Ensure that the controller in the project you wish to address fixtures for has been assigned a live (currently online) controller and that the project has been uploaded to the live controller
226 226  1. Open the project in Designer 2 and navigate to the "Patch" page
227 -1. Select the controller that you wish to address fixtures for
228 -1. Press the "Discover" button that corresponds to the output that you want to address fixtures for
227 +1. Select the controller that you wish to address devices for
228 +1. Press the "Discover" button that corresponds to the output that you want to address devices for
229 229  1*. Single-universe LPCs have separate "Discover" buttons corresponding to each of the two DMX outputs
230 230  1*. Multi-universe LPCs and EDNs typically have a single "Discover" button for each universe, as there is a 1-to-1 relationship between the output and the universe
231 -1.
231 +1. A window will appear and list all discovered devices, along with a unique device ID, manufacturer/model information, personality (control mode), footprint (number of required addresses), and their current start address
232 +1*. Due to manufacturer compatibility issues, some RDM-capable devices may not appear online, and available information (such as personality) may be incomplete for those devices that are online
233 +1*. Non-driver devices (such as splitters) will appear in the list, but it will not be possible to change their start address
234 +1*. In cases where RDM capable devices do not appear online, they must be addressed manually as described on our [[DMX Fixture Addressing page>>doc:SHOWRUNNER™ Setup Guide.SHOWRUNNER™ Installation Guide.Device Addressing.DMX Fixture Addressing.WebHome||anchor="HAddressingDrivers"]]
235 +1. Click the "Identify" button and then select the device from the list of available devices in order to identify a specific RDM device
236 +1*. The device should identify itself by flashing any attached loads (if a driver), or by flashing indicator LEDs (if it is another type of device, such as a splitter)
237 +1. To change a device's start address, double-click its start address and type the new start address
238 +1. Once all devices have been identified and re-addressed, click the "Discover" button to refresh the list and verify that no new devices appear online
239 +1. Repeat steps 3 through 8 for all controllers
240 +1. If discovering on all outputs of all controllers does not reveal all the expected drivers, then it may be necessary to manually address drivers as described on our [[DMX Fixture Addressing page>>doc:SHOWRUNNER™ Setup Guide.SHOWRUNNER™ Installation Guide.Device Addressing.DMX Fixture Addressing.WebHome||anchor="HAddressingDrivers"]] and move on to troubleshooting the DMX installation
